The Basics of Quantum AI Trading
Quantum AI Trading is a revolutionary blend of quantum computing and artificial intelligence applied to trading. Quantum computing harnesses the unique properties of quantum bits or qubits, which can exist in multiple states simultaneously, allowing for superior computational power. This power is leveraged by AI algorithms that can analyze immense data sets, recognizing patterns and trends far beyond traditional capabilities. By utilizing Quantum AI, traders can anticipate market movements and develop strategies that yield higher returns.
The essence of Quantum AI Trading lies in its ability to perform complex calculations and simulations within a shorter time frame. Traditional AI-based trading methods often rely on historical data to predict future outcomes. In contrast, quantum algorithms can simulate a multitude of potential scenarios concurrently, providing traders with insights that are more dynamically attuned to current market conditions. Notably, the efficiency of quantum processors in executing these computations offers a decisive edge in high-frequency trading environments.

Challenges of Implementing Quantum AI Trading
The implementation of Quantum AI Trading, while promising, is fraught with challenges that need careful consideration. One of the primary hurdles is the current state of quantum technology itself, which is still in its infancy. Quantum computers are not yet widely accessible; thus, developing compatible algorithms requires significant investment in research and development.
Moreover, the steep learning curve associated with quantum computing poses another challenge. Many traders and financial professionals may find it difficult to grasp the complexities involved, creating a barrier to entry into this advanced trading strategy. Training and education efforts must address these gaps to ensure that market participants can effectively leverage the technology.
Furthermore, regulatory issues present significant challenges, particularly regarding data security and the trading of financial instruments involving quantum technologies. The evolving regulatory landscape needs to support innovation while safeguarding the interests of traders and investors alike.
